S 296 South Carolina Senate · 2021-2022 Regular Session

Golf carts

Summary
A BILL TO AMEND SECTION 56-2-105 OF THE 1976 CODE, RELATING TO THE DEPARTMENT OF MOTOR VEHICLES' ISSUANCE OF GOLF CART PERMITS AND THE OPERATION OF GOLF CARTS ALONG THE STATE'S HIGHWAYS, TO PROVIDE THAT A MUNICIPALITY OF A CERTAIN SIZE AND POPULATION MAY ADOPT AN ORDINANCE THAT ALLOWS FOR THE OPERATION DURING NON-DAYLIGHT HOURS OF GOLF CARTS THAT ARE EQUIPPED WITH WORKING HEADLIGHTS AND REAR LIGHTS.
